Iglesia de San Pedro
Iglesia de San Pedro
The Iglesia de San Pedro is one of the oldest churches in La Paz, located in the San Pedro district. After enduring several fires and subsequent reconstructions, the building now features an understated facade. Travelers visit this site for its simple architecture and the quiet square surrounding it, which offers a calm environment for a walk within the city.
Getting There
The church is located within the central urban area of La Paz. From the city center, it is accessible via a short taxi ride or a walk of approximately 10 to 15 minutes, depending on your starting point.
Duration of Visit
Because of its modest size and the quiet nature of the surrounding plaza, most visitors spend between 30 and 60 minutes at this location.
When to Visit
Visiting during the weekday mornings typically provides the quietest experience. As it is located near busy urban districts, the surrounding streets can become crowded during peak business hours and midday.
